The jaw joint is one of the busiest joints in the body and has a great influence on almost its entire alignment! You may feel it hurts, especially when opening your mouth, chewing and in some cases even at rest. Pain can be located directly in the joint (just in front of the ear) or radiate to the teeth and head. Cracking and restriction of mouth opening are common coexisting symptoms. There are various causes of TMJ pain. It can occur as a result of injury or inflammation process inside the joint. The jaw joint is influenced by the position of the teeth, that’s why sometimes a simple visit with Your dentist can cause problems. Another interesting fact is that masticatory muscles often react to mental stress.
